Renters insurance costs in Delaware vary depending on your coverage level, insurance provider, and personal circumstances. On average, renters in Delaware pay $207 per year or $17 per month for a policy that includes $40,000 in personal property coverage, $300,000 in liability protection and a $1,000 deductible. Key Takeaways The average cost of renters insurance in Delaware is $207 per year or $17 per month.Cumberland Insurance provides the least expensive renters insurance in Delaware at an average rate of $123 annually.Renters insurance rates can vary significantly among insurance companies. Compare quotes to find the best deal on renters insurance in Delaware. Average renters insurance cost in Delaware per monthThe average cost of renters insurance in Delaware is $17 per month. Your premium may vary depending on your location, the value of your belongings, and the coverage limits you select. This applies to your dwelling and personal belongings claims. $1,000 $500 $1,000 Calculate $194/year Estimated renters insurance rates in Delaware $16 Monthly renters insurance cost in Delaware -28% Compared to national average Get quotes Average cost of renters insurance in Delaware by coverage levelAs we discussed above, the average cost of renters insurance in Delaware is $207 per year. These rates are for a coverage level of $40,000 for personal property coverage, $300,000 in liability coverage and a $1000 deductible.However, if you lower the personal property coverage from $40,000 to $20,000, you will pay $151 per year for renters insurance in Delaware, which provides $300,000 in liability protection with a $1000 deductible.Below are the average renters insurance costs in Delaware for personal property coverage amounts of $20,000 and $40,000.Coverage levelAverage annual renters insurance rateAverage monthly renters insurance rate$20,000 with $500 Deductible and $100,000 Liability$157$13$20,000 with $500 Deductible and $300,000 Liability$167$14$20,000 with $1,000 Deductible and $100,000 Liability$141$12$20,000 with $1,000 Deductible and $300,000 Liability$151$13$40,000 with $500 Deductible and $100,000 Liability$218$18$40,000 with $500 Deductible and $300,000 Liability$231$19$40,000 with $1,000 Deductible and $100,000 Liability$194$16$40,000 with $1,000 Deductible and $300,000 Liability$207$17$60,000 with $500 Deductible and $100,000 Liability$302$25$60,000 with $500 Deductible and $300,000 Liability$316$26$60,000 with $1,000 Deductible and $100,000 Liability$269$22$60,000 with $1,000 Deductible and $300,000 Liability$282$24Powered by:Average cost of renters insurance in Delaware by cityRenters insurance rates can vary widely between cities.
